Apple CEO Tim Cook, did not expect that his company’s announcement introducing the new iPad Pro would end up generating a huge wave of indignation: “Meet the new iPad Pro: the thinnest product we have ever created, the most advanced screen we have ever produced , with the incredible power of the M4 chip. Imagine all the things it will be used for,” the Apple CEO published on X (Twitter). The problem? An advertisement that is pure destruction, and which tries to show everything that an iPad Pro has and can do, but destroying musical instruments, recreational machines, art and everything you can imagine. The result? The fury of social networks.

Social networks explode against Apple’s latest announcement

One of the funniest responses was made by the Iranian filmmaker Reza Sixo Safai, literally turning the advertisement around and demonstrating that in a very different way Apple could have achieved the completely opposite effect of the wave of criticism and rejection.

Answers and critics of all possible colors and countries, with comments like that of the user on X (Twitter) @usaotoday, who points out that “I can’t identify with this video at all. “He lacks respect for the creative team and mocks the creators.” Judd Baroff, another user of the social network, wrote that “I’m not sure that the wanton destruction of all the good and beautiful things in this world was really the vibe you were looking for.”

Destroy art to show that everything fits in something as flat as the new iPad Pro has not been a great idea on Apple’s part. Technology is more within reach than ever, but we must not forget where we come from and that, in one way or another, everything that destroys in the advertisement is still important to millions of people.
